Optimizing Brain Health of United States Special Operations Forces
Summary
Repeated blast exposure in military personnel may cause brain injury, but a diagnostic test is lacking. Developing a reliable test for repeated blast brain injury (rBBI) could improve brain health and readiness.
Area of Science:
- Neuroscience
- Military Medicine
- Traumatic Brain Injury
Background:
- US Special Operations Forces (SOF) face frequent explosive blast exposure.
- The neurological effects of repeated blast exposure are not fully understood.
- No diagnostic test currently exists for repeated blast brain injury (rBBI).
Purpose of the Study:
- To discuss the importance of developing a diagnostic test for rBBI.
- To highlight the potential benefits of such a test for SOF personnel.
- To emphasize the role of diagnostic testing in human performance optimization.
Main Methods:
- This article is a discussion and review of the current state of knowledge.
- It synthesizes existing information on blast exposure and brain injury.
- It proposes the need for diagnostic test development.
Main Results:
- The effects of repeated blast exposure on the brain remain incompletely understood.
- The absence of a diagnostic test for rBBI poses a significant challenge.
- A reliable diagnostic test could significantly aid in managing SOF brain health.
Conclusions:
- Developing a reliable diagnostic test for rBBI is crucial.
- Such a test has the potential to enhance SOF brain health.
- Implementing a diagnostic test can improve combat readiness and quality of life.
